The Richard and Judy Book Club was founded in 2004 by television presenters Richard Madeley and Judy Finnigan. The inspiration behind creating the book club was their desire to extend their passion for literature and engage with their audience on a deeper level by recommending and discussing captivating reads. Because to be the best, you must beat the best, and there are rivals on my tail. July 1346.Ten men land on the beaches of Normandy. They call themselves the Essex Dogs: an unruly platoon of archers and men-at-arms led by a battle-scarred captain whose best days are behind him. The fight for the throne of the largest kingdom in Western Europe has begun.
